前端项目管理系统有哪些

前端项目管理系统有哪些

前端项目管理系统有许多选择,包括Jira、Trello、Asana、PingCodeWorktile等。这些系统可以帮助开发团队更好地组织任务、提升协作效率、跟踪项目进度。PingCode和Worktile是两个特别推荐的系统,因为它们提供了丰富的功能和高度的灵活性,其中PingCode专注于研发项目管理,而Worktile则是一款通用项目管理软件,非常适合前端项目管理。

一、前端项目管理系统的重要性

在前端开发项目中,管理系统的作用至关重要。由于前端开发通常涉及多个团队成员的协作,包括设计师、开发人员和测试人员,一个高效的项目管理系统能够确保任务的清晰分配和顺利执行,从而提高整个项目的效率和质量。

二、Jira

Jira是一个非常流行的项目管理工具,特别是在软件开发领域。它由Atlassian开发,提供了丰富的功能,包括任务跟踪、缺陷管理和敏捷开发支持。

  1. 任务管理:Jira允许团队创建、分配和跟踪任务,从而确保每个任务都有明确的责任人和截止日期。
  2. 敏捷开发支持:Jira支持Scrum和Kanban方法,帮助团队更好地进行敏捷开发。
  3. 报告和分析:Jira提供了多种报告和分析工具,帮助团队了解项目进展和绩效。

三、Trello

Trello是一个以看板(Kanban)为基础的项目管理工具,使用简单、直观,非常适合小型团队和个人项目。

  1. 看板视图:Trello的核心是看板视图,用户可以创建多个看板,每个看板包含多个列表和卡片,用于表示不同的任务和阶段。
  2. 协作功能:Trello支持团队成员之间的实时协作,用户可以在卡片上添加评论、附件和截止日期。
  3. 集成性:Trello支持与多种第三方工具的集成,如Slack、Google Drive等,进一步提升了它的灵活性和实用性。

四、Asana

Asana是一款功能强大的项目管理工具,适用于各种规模的团队和项目。它提供了多种视图和功能,帮助团队有效地管理任务和项目。

  1. 任务分配和跟踪:Asana允许用户创建任务、分配任务负责人、设定截止日期,并跟踪任务的完成情况。
  2. 项目视图:Asana提供了看板视图、列表视图和时间线视图,用户可以根据需要选择最适合的视图。
  3. 自动化和模板:Asana支持任务自动化和项目模板,帮助团队节省时间和提高效率。

五、PingCode

PingCode是一个专注于研发项目管理的系统,提供了全面的功能,支持从需求管理到发布管理的全过程。

  1. 需求管理:PingCode提供了强大的需求管理功能,帮助团队捕捉、分析和跟踪需求,确保项目按需进行。
  2. 任务管理和跟踪:PingCode支持任务的创建、分配和跟踪,用户可以通过看板、列表和甘特图等多种视图来管理任务。
  3. 集成性:PingCode支持与多种开发工具和平台的集成,如GitHub、GitLab等,进一步提升了它的实用性和灵活性。

六、Worktile

Worktile是一款通用项目管理软件,适用于各种类型的项目和团队。它提供了丰富的功能,帮助团队更好地协作和管理项目。

  1. 任务管理:Worktile允许用户创建、分配和跟踪任务,并支持多种视图,如看板、列表和甘特图视图。
  2. 团队协作:Worktile支持团队成员之间的实时协作,用户可以在任务中添加评论、附件和截止日期。
  3. 报告和分析:Worktile提供了多种报告和分析工具,帮助团队了解项目进展和绩效。

七、选择合适的前端项目管理系统

选择适合的前端项目管理系统需要考虑团队规模、项目类型和具体需求。以下是一些选择建议:

  1. 小型团队和个人项目:Trello和Asana是不错的选择,它们的界面简单直观,易于上手。
  2. 中大型团队和复杂项目:Jira和PingCode提供了更强大的功能和灵活性,适合需要高级任务管理和报告功能的团队。
  3. 通用需求:Worktile是一款通用项目管理软件,适用于各种类型的项目和团队,提供了丰富的功能和多种视图。

八、如何提升项目管理效率

使用前端项目管理系统可以极大地提升项目管理的效率,但要达到最佳效果,还需要注意以下几点:

  1. 清晰的任务分配:确保每个任务都有明确的负责人和截止日期,避免任务无人负责或延期。
  2. 定期的项目审查:定期审查项目进展,及时发现和解决问题,确保项目按计划进行。
  3. 有效的沟通和协作:利用项目管理系统的协作功能,保持团队成员之间的有效沟通,及时分享信息和反馈。

九、总结

前端项目管理系统是提升团队协作效率和项目管理质量的重要工具。Jira、Trello、Asana、PingCode和Worktile都是优秀的选择,每个系统都有其独特的功能和优势。选择适合的系统需要根据团队规模、项目类型和具体需求进行综合考虑。同时,合理使用项目管理系统,确保清晰的任务分配、定期的项目审查和有效的沟通和协作,能够进一步提升项目管理的效率和质量。

相关问答FAQs:

1. 前端项目管理系统有什么作用?

前端项目管理系统可以帮助团队更好地组织和协调前端开发工作。它提供了任务分配、进度追踪、团队协作、版本控制等功能,可以提高开发效率,保证项目的质量和进度。

2. 前端项目管理系统应该具备哪些基本功能?

一个好的前端项目管理系统应该具备任务管理、项目进度追踪、团队协作、版本控制、文档管理等基本功能。此外,还可以有代码托管、自动化构建、测试等高级功能,以满足不同团队的需求。

3. 如何选择适合自己团队的前端项目管理系统?

选择前端项目管理系统时,可以考虑以下几点:

  • 功能是否齐全,是否能满足团队的需求?
  • 界面是否友好,易于使用和操作?
  • 是否支持团队协作,能够方便地分配任务和跟踪进度?
  • 是否有良好的文档管理和版本控制机制?
  • 是否支持与其他开发工具的集成,如代码托管、自动化构建等?
  • 是否有良好的技术支持和社区生态?

通过综合考虑这些因素,可以选择一个适合自己团队的前端项目管理系统。

文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/713341

(0)
Edit2Edit2
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部